Transaction 121bd246d6bf1641ee99f42a73ec0cdf7b3d839a287e22444d98c382e2783b80

1 Input
2 Outputs
  • 121bd246d6bf1641ee99f42a73ec0cdf7b3d839a287e22444d98c382e2783b80:0
  • value  1037238
    address  1KFcbZf4NVn2dYTc6VeEUzRE83X9NrYJqG
  • 121bd246d6bf1641ee99f42a73ec0cdf7b3d839a287e22444d98c382e2783b80:1
  • value  98478714
    address  12myNeEfAjU7VfzaPteowd1r8CseuN4y45